Vendor note for new team members: canary gating on the Bramblewick platform is enforced by our vendor, Opaline Systems, not by us. Their Gatewright tool holds each canary at 5% traffic until error rate, latency p95, and saturation all pass for 30 minutes. We cannot override the hold; only Opaline's release desk can. Document any gating dispute in the vendor log before requesting an exception. For exception requests, write to their release desk directly.

alerts address for bahaf-kaduf: zorox@qorvelio.internal

Handover — orders soft deletes (Mirabeck service)

Orders are never hard-deleted; we set a deleted_at timestamp and a reaper job purges rows after the retention window. If the reaper stalls, the table bloats and the nightly export slows noticeably. Check the reaper's last-run metric before escalating. It reads its retention and batch settings from the values below.

service settings:
PRAIX_LOG_LEVEL=error
PRAIX_METRICS_HOST=metrics.praix.qorvelcorp.corp
PRAIX_POOL_SIZE=16

☐ Lost-badge procedure (contractors)

If your visitor badge goes missing at Thornquay Depot, report it to the gatehouse immediately — do not tailgate through doors. A replacement is issued once your host confirms identity. The old badge is deactivated within minutes. Until your replacement arrives, use the contractor side entrance, which requires the temporary door code given below.

staff pass of kawip-hawef = bdg-QLP-2